Worthy of Commitment introduces the concept of Living Organisation Development (OD) as a pathway for creating workplaces grounded in the wisdom of living systems found in nature - places that are productive, deeply human and regenerative. Drawing on their practice spanning over the past two-and-a-half… decades, this book illuminates the principles of Living OD in action to unlock flourishing organisations.It seeks to answer a fundamental question: What does an organisation truly worthy of people's commitment look like, and how can we create one? It invites the readers to become active agents in creating organisations, communities and nations that are life-centric. Within these pages, you will discover inspiring ideas and actionable insights on how to apply these principles and practices to enable positive change at any scale.

Edited by Xin Tan / Satomi Ichiba. Drawings by Jacqueline Lssksonen. From rear cover: "Since moving to Australia from The Netherlands it was Jacqueline's inspiration to be a write…r. Jacqueline loves her dogs, Australian animals and the Australian bush. She decided to combine the two. This resulted in this children's book which adults like to read as well. If you let your imagination run free you will be able to see the Aussie bush, its animals, the heat and bushfires through her eyes. Woven into it are Fairies and Elves. This story is a wonderful tale of imagination". No date (circa 2000?). A very nice clean tight solid softcover copy. 103pp. Scarce. SB-54.
